Autor |
Nachricht |
isara
Threadersteller
Dabei seit: 08.12.2007
Ort: vel
Alter: 56
Geschlecht:
|
Verfasst Sa 08.12.2007 18:59
Titel Wortabstände mit CSS definieren |
|
|
Hallo,
ich bin noch blutiger CSS-Anfänger und wäre für einen Tipp bei folgendem Problem sehr dankbar: Ich möchte eine Zeitliste machen, die in etwa so aussieht:
Vita
1968 geboren in München
1998 Ausstellung im Kloster Gravenhorst
2001-04 Studium an der Freien Kunstakademie Rhein-Ruhr
Nach den Jahreszahlen soll ein Freiraum sein und der nachfolgende Text soll ebenfalls linksbündig sein.
Offensichtlich kann ich ja nicht mit einfachen Leerzeichen oder Tabulatoren arbeiten. Und alles, was ich bislang zum Thema "Leerzeichen" im Bereich CSS gefunden habe, beschäftigt sich mit white-space, der den Zeilenumbruch verhindern soll. Gesehen habe ich soetwas auf dieser Seite www.basch.de. Nur habe ich weder im CSS noch im HTLM etwas gefunden, was mich weiterbringt - wahrscheinlich, weil ich auch gar nicht genau weiß, WONACH ich suchen soll.
Wie gesagt: Für einen Tipp oder einen Link oder Ähnliches wäre ich superdankbar.
Liebe Grüße
Isara
|
|
|
|
|
sahnemuh
Dabei seit: 19.06.2003
Ort: /dev/null
Alter: 42
Geschlecht:
|
Verfasst Sa 08.12.2007 19:11
Titel
|
|
|
Code: | <style type="text/css">
table#vitae th.year,
table#vitae tbody tr:first-child {
width: 3em;
}
</style>
<table id="vitae" summary="Curriculum Vitae von Xyz">
<caption>Vita</caption>
<thead>
<tr>
<th scope="col" class="year">
Jahr
</th>
<th scope="col" class="event">
Ereignis
</th>
</tr>
</thead>
<tbody>
<tr>
<td>
1968
</td>
<td>
geboren in München
</td>
</tr>
<tr>
<td>
2001-04
</td>
<td>
Ausstellung im Kloster Gravenhorst
</td>
</tr>
<tr>
<td>
1968
</td>
<td>
Studium an der Freien Kunstakademie Rhein-Ruhr
</td>
</tr>
</tbody>
</table>
|
Zuletzt bearbeitet von sahnemuh am Sa 08.12.2007 19:13, insgesamt 1-mal bearbeitet
|
|
|
|
|
Anzeige
|
|
|
isara
Threadersteller
Dabei seit: 08.12.2007
Ort: vel
Alter: 56
Geschlecht:
|
Verfasst Sa 08.12.2007 20:05
Titel
|
|
|
Ich werde mich wohl erst morgen mit Sinn und Verstand da durchwühlen können, dir aber trotzdem schon mal vielen Dank für deine schnelle Hilfe! So wie ich es verstehe, komme ich da also mit einer reinen CSS-Vorgabe nicht weiter, sondern muss doch mit Tabellen arbeiten, oder?
|
|
|
|
|
deliciious
Dabei seit: 15.11.2006
Ort: Essen
Alter: 39
Geschlecht:
|
Verfasst Sa 08.12.2007 20:08
Titel
|
|
|
isara hat geschrieben: | Ich werde mich wohl erst morgen mit Sinn und Verstand da durchwühlen können, dir aber trotzdem schon mal vielen Dank für deine schnelle Hilfe! So wie ich es verstehe, komme ich da also mit einer reinen CSS-Vorgabe nicht weiter, sondern muss doch mit Tabellen arbeiten, oder? |
in diesem fall ist eine tabelle für den inhalt doch mehr als angebracht, ist doch schliesslich auch n tabellarischer lebenslauf?? solange man nicht das design durch tabellen erstellt (darauf zielt dein kommentar wohl ab) ist doch alles okay.
|
|
|
|
|
isara
Threadersteller
Dabei seit: 08.12.2007
Ort: vel
Alter: 56
Geschlecht:
|
Verfasst Sa 08.12.2007 20:23
Titel
|
|
|
Das stimmt natürlich auch! Ich habe mich nur gewundert, da ich auf meinem Musterlink www.basch.de keinen solchen Tabellen-Code gefunden habe. Also habe ich mich gefragt, wie zum Henker die das da wohl gemacht haben. Ich will ja schließlich CSS lernen...
|
|
|
|
|
sahnemuh
Dabei seit: 19.06.2003
Ort: /dev/null
Alter: 42
Geschlecht:
|
Verfasst Sa 08.12.2007 20:26
Titel
|
|
|
wie mein vorredner schon sagte: tabellarische daten gehören in eine tabelle. ganz einfach eigentlich
die maßgabee "keine tabellen mehr zu nutzen" bedeutet nur, sie nicht zweck zu entfremden (z.B zu layout zwecken anderer Inhalte als tabellarischer).
zu dem in der tabelle eingesetzten markup gibt es hier eine erklärung.
|
|
|
|
|
sahnemuh
Dabei seit: 19.06.2003
Ort: /dev/null
Alter: 42
Geschlecht:
|
Verfasst Sa 08.12.2007 20:28
Titel
|
|
|
isara hat geschrieben: | Das stimmt natürlich auch! Ich habe mich nur gewundert, da ich auf meinem Musterlink www.basch.de keinen solchen Tabellen-Code gefunden habe. Also habe ich mich gefragt, wie zum Henker die das da wohl gemacht haben. Ich will ja schließlich CSS lernen... |
hö? - schau nochmal hin:
Code: |
<div id="inhalt">
<table border="0" cellspacing="0" cellpadding="1"><tr><td valign="top"> </td><td valign="top"><b> </td></tr><tr><td valign="top">2005 </td><td valign="top">Deutsche Akademie Villa Massimo Rom </td></tr><tr><td valign="top"> </td><td valign="top">Katalogförderung der Stiftung Kunstfonds e.V., Bonn1985-93 </td></tr><tr><td valign="top">2004 </td><td valign="top">Ausslandsstipendium des Berliner Senats für Istanbul </td></tr><tr><td valign="top">2001 </td>[...]
|
|
|
|
|
|
m
Moderator
Dabei seit: 18.11.2004
Ort: -
Alter: -
Geschlecht:
|
Verfasst Sa 08.12.2007 21:53
Titel
|
|
|
Wenn du nur eine kleine Liste mit Daten hast, könnte eine weitere meiner Meinung
nach sinngemäße Lösung in etwa so aussehen.
Code: | <h1>Daten zu meiner Person ... </h1>
<ol>
<li value="1980">Ereignis</li>
<li value="1985">Ereignis</li>
<li value="1990">Ereignis</li>
<li value="1995">Ereignis</li>
<li value="2000">Ereignis</li>
</ol> |
|
|
|
|
|
|
|
|
Ähnliche Themen |
pop up´s definieren?
[CSS] a zustände definieren
Imagemaps definieren
Hintergrund.Definieren?
Web sichere farben definieren?
div height richtig in css definieren
|
|